Pros
- Competitive salaries and excellent health insurance. - If you are a rock-star performer, it will be noticed and likely rewarded. - Company is a minority-owned small business and has minorities in several key senior positions. - You can advance quickly here. - The company employs some very talented individuals that are a pleasure to work with.
Kontras
- Because the company is so small, you should expect to have to find another job yourself when a contract ends. There is no "bench" between assignments. - Atmosphere is cliquey. While what you know will help you here (see above), who you know will get you farther. For example, office assignments don't seem to be based on seniority. The choice, private offices just seem to go to management's favorites. - The company has a tendency to put inexperienced people in positions of authority. I found myself working under someone who, while extremely talented and intelligent, was not skilled at people management and was relatively inexperienced in general. - HR processes are not mature. For example, they had to lay off several people towards the end of their largest contract and did so with no notice and very limited severance (just a few days). They were mostly senior (and probably expensive) people rather than those who were performing poorly. - By the same token, gross incompetence is not dealt with effectively or swiftly. You should expect to have to work with and for people who aren't very good at their jobs and/or are lazy. While there are a lot of great people here, there is also a lot of dead weight.
